| dc.description.abstract | A substation is an electrical system with a high voltage capacity that is used for the control of electrical circuits, generators, and other pieces of equipment. Utilization of substations may assist in lowering the high voltage of the electrical power that is being transported. Substation maintenance is the process of periodic, planned inspection, repair, and replacement of all switchgear, buildings, and ancillary equipment in substation installations. A substation's planned maintenance has many benefits; it can save money and prevent equipment wear and tear. Modern power systems are very complex in nature and produce transients during various operations. Backup protection units can be used to solve the problem when a protection device happens to fail. SABP can increase the range of information sharing in a substation area and help to improve the overall performance of the protection system.
